Analysis

Republic of Moldova recorded 0.1721 for teachers, as a share of public total employees in 2015.

The figure is down 9.8% on the previous year and up 8.3% over ten years.

Over the whole period, teachers, as a share of public total employees in Republic of Moldova peaked at 0.1907 in 2014 and was at its lowest, 0.1224, in 2012.

Republic of Moldova ranks 13th of 25 countries on this measure, in the middle of the range.
